Voltcraft VC-539 Information
The Voltcraft VC-539 is a digital clamp meter that measures AC and DC current, voltage, frequency, resistance, capacitance, and temperature. It has a CAT III 600 V rating, making it safe to use on live circuits. The VC-539 features a backlit LCD display with 4000 counts, automatic range selection, and a HOLD function to freeze the displayed measurement. It also has a beveled jaw for easy wire insertion, a high-response bargraph display, and a Max Hold function for measuring inrush currents.
